Output 17ceba86a3528490ff87615258577e2e8a0157392295897e35497c988a5dd60b:3

value
1664618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 169d1312b0182fa379d1ddd71ce9cf83ed63777a OP_EQUAL
address
33kaxVUxHavZpLY72CW9tQgECtoovpLDTV
transaction
17ceba86a3528490ff87615258577e2e8a0157392295897e35497c988a5dd60b
spent
true